Jann Taber is the President of Rebel Public Relations, LLC and has more than 25 years of experience working for and with the news media and has generated millions of dollars worth of free publicity for clients and employers.

She served as the news manager for Pacific Gas and Electric Company (Fortune 100) where she created and coordinated the company’s “Good News Bureau” and was a company spokesperson. She provided strategic communications advice that helped the company through the energy crisis, as well as a hostile takeover attempt by a government-owned utility.

She also served as former-Governor Pete Wilson’s appointed head of communications for the California Health and Welfare Agency, where she directed PR for the largest state agency in the nation, with its 42,000 employees and $46-plus billion budget.

Jann started her career as a radio reporter and anchor and has a thorough understanding of TV news, having worked for several television news departments. She earned a Master of Arts degree in corporate and political public relations and a Bachelor of Arts degree in information and communication studies – with an emphasis in broadcast journalism – from California State University, Chico.

Jann is the visionary of the Sacramento AWRT Good News Awards, which recognize news coverage that furthers the triumph of the human spirit and provides over $35,000 a year to charitable organizations and student scholarships. She is a founder of the Small Business Development Center’s Women in Business Seminar series. She is frequently asked to share her PR expertise on professional panels and roundtables.

Jann is the author of the motivational/inspirational book, Moving Providence: A Formula for Creating an Extraordinary Life.
